Carbon and Sulfur Analyzer

Lab Expo Elemental Analyzer units are configured for quantitative carbon and sulfur determination in metals, minerals, and industrial materials. The range supports carbon analysis from 0.00002% to 99.9% and sulfur analysis from 0.00001% to 5% with precision up to 0.00001% and low relative standard deviation values. Systems integrate combustion-based analysis and controlled detection workflows, supporting material characterization, process verification, and quality assessment in analytical and production environments.

FAQ for Carbon and Sulfur Analyzer

1: What is the purpose of a Carbon and Sulfur Analyzer?

It is used for accurate detection and analysis of carbon and sulfur content in various materials.

2: How does the analyzer ensure measurement accuracy?

They use a separate combustion and infrared design, along with a precise gas control mechanism to deliver stable and reliable results over long-term use.

3: Can the analyzer operate continuously?

Yes, the built-in back-flushing system supports automatic self-cleaning, allowing continuous analysis with minimal interruption.

4: What safety features are included?

The analyzer is equipped with integrated gas control and protective mechanisms to ensure safe operation in laboratory environments.

5: What industries commonly use this analyzer?

This analyzer is widely used in metallurgy, mining, and scientific research laboratories where precise elemental analysis is essential.
